## Data Architecture & Schema

### JSON Schema Specification

```json theme={null}
{
  "instruction": "string",
  "input": "string", 
  "output": "string"
}
```

### Field Architecture Documentation

| Field         | Data Type | Description                                           | Implementation Notes                    |
| ------------- | --------- | ----------------------------------------------------- | --------------------------------------- |
| `instruction` | String    | System context and role definition for AI systems     | Contextual framework for model behavior |
| `input`       | String    | Clinical query, patient scenario, or medical question | Primary content for processing          |
| `output`      | String    | Evidence-based medical response or clinical guidance  | Validated medical content output        |

## Dataset Analytics & Metrics

### Statistical Overview

| Dataset Collection        | Content Type | Avg Input Length | Avg Output Length | Clinical Focus               |
| ------------------------- | ------------ | ---------------- | ----------------- | ---------------------------- |
| **General Medical**       | Educational  | 17.1 tokens      | 33.1 tokens       | Balanced medical terminology |
| **Medical Assessment**    | Examination  | 30.1 tokens      | 2.7 tokens        | Diagnostic evaluation        |
| **Clinical Consultation** | Dialogue     | 23.0 tokens      | 44.8 tokens       | Patient-provider interaction |

## API Architecture & Documentation

### RESTful API Endpoints

```bash theme={null}
# Enterprise Authentication
curl -H "Authorization: Bearer ENTERPRISE_API_KEY" \
     -H "Content-Type: application/json" \
     https://api.datamaster.tech/v2/medical-datasets

# Dataset Catalog Access
GET /v2/medical-datasets
Response: Complete catalog with metadata

# Individual Dataset Retrieval
GET /v2/medical-datasets/{collection_id}
Response: Specific dataset with full content

# Advanced Query Interface
POST /v2/medical-datasets/{collection_id}/query
Body: {"query": "clinical_criteria", "filters": {...}}
Response: Filtered medical content
```

### GraphQL Schema

```graphql theme={null}
type MedicalDataset {
  id: ID!
  name: String!
  description: String!
  medicalAccuracy: Float!
  clinicalRelevance: Float!
  dataIntegrity: Float!
  entries: [MedicalEntry!]!
}

type MedicalEntry {
  instruction: String!
  input: String!
  output: String!
  medicalDomain: String
  clinicalComplexity: String
}
```
